Si4704/05
Enhanced Broadcast FM Radio Receiver for Portable Applications
Description
The Si4704/05 enhanced FM receiver is the most
advanced portable solution available today offering
embedded antenna support, digital audio out, worldwide
FM band support, and highly flexible, mature, and proven
FM functionality in a simple API. The Si4704/05
incorporates Silicon Labs' tuned-resonance antenna
technology for crystal clear FM reception in wire-free
device enclosures. Silabs' internationally patented tuned-
resonance technology allows embedded FM antennas
such as PCB traces, loops, stubs, or other devices to
perform exceptionally well, enabling devices with
integrated Bluetooth to receive FM transmissions without
an external FM antenna, and transmit the FM content to
Bluetooth-enabled headsets. This is the best, most cost-
effective solution to enable wire-free FM reception.
The Si4705 also offers digital audio out for FM recording.
Content recorded over the Si4705 can be shared with
friends or played at a later time in MP3 format. The content
can also be tagged with RDS information, allowing song
name and artist labels to be displayed as is done with MP3
meta data. Using the digital audio out, the Si4705 can also
reduce total system power consumption by avoiding
unnecessary ADC/DAC conversions between the FM
receiver and the host processor.
The Si4704/05 truly supports worldwide FM bands, starting
at 64 MHz for Eastern European countries and extending
all the way to 108 MHz for the rest of the world. The device
supports channel spacing down to 10 kHz, and includes
advanced, proven seek functionality. All the Silicon Labs
proven FM receiver expertise is incorporated in the Si4704/
05, gained through thousands of designs with almost every
OEM and ODM in the world and over 100 million devices
shipped.

competing solutions. The Si4705 incorporates Silicon Labs'
proven and widely adopted RDS processor, including
worldwide compliance, all symbol decoding, error
detection, error correction, and other RDS functions. The
Si4705 RDS functionality is unmatched in the industry for
performance, on-chip processing, and worldwide adoption.
